The CHIP-8 emulator.

PONG, SPACE INVADERS, PACMAN, BRIX and TANK: the ultimate retro games. The CHIP8 is a language interpreter that allows users to re-create some VERY simple retro games. CHIP-8 programs are very small, they cannot be any larger than 4Kb. This would explain the lack of "colourful imagry" in them. They consist of basic white "brick" looking shapes on a black background which visually doesnt give the user much to think about.
